    Rally Finland: Evans now in control 

    Day three of Rally Finland will start with a Elfyn Evans in control of a rally that has claimed it’s causalities already.

    Evans elevated to the lead of the Secto-rally Finland after teammate Kalle Rovanperä rolled his Yaris and retired from the event in the Friday afternoon loop. 

    The Welshman starts day three with a 6.9seconds lead over Hyundai’s Thierry Neuville. 

    “We are pretty happy overall and obviously we have still got a lot of driving to do,” said Evans. 

    Rovanpera who was leading the rally by 5.7seconds by stage 7 had an impressive performance come to an end in stage eight after a roll; an incident he termed stupid from their side. 

    Rovanpera joined Hyundai’s Esapekka Lappi and M-Sport Ford’s Ott Tanak and Pierre-Louis Loubet who has earlier retired out of the event in the morning loop of Friday. 

    Despite reporting mechanical glitches, and struggling with visibility on stages, Thierry Neuville maintained his podium position by end of leg two. Neuville however has Takamoto Katsuta breathing down neck into the third leg. 

    Teemu Suninen is chasing from the fourth position followed by Jari-Matti Latvala who is experiencing the Hybrid Rally1 car for the first time. 

    In the WRC2, Jari Huttunen in a Skoda Fabia leads the category and stands sixth overall. Nikolay Gryazin, Oliver Solberg and Andrien Fourmaux complete the top ten in that order.
